James Nathaniel Brown is a former American football player, sports analyst and actor. He was a fullback for the Cleveland Browns of the National Football Federation from 1957 to 1965. Considered one of the greatest full-backs of all time, as well as one of the greatest players in NFL history, Brown was a guest to the Pro Bowl every season he entered the tournament, three times. recognized as AP NFL MVP. , and won an NFL championship with the Browns in 1964. He led the tournament in terms of fast-rush pitches in eight of his nine seasons, and until retiring, he broke. most of the record of major races. In 2002, he was named by The Sporting News as the greatest professional football player of all time. Brown won an Honorable All-American Consensus while playing college football at Syracuse University, where he was a versatile player for the Syracuse Orangemen football team. He also excelled in basketball, athletics and lacrosse.

From 1957 to 1965, he played for the Cleveland Browns and was inducted into the NFL Hall of Fame as a running back. He was selected to the Pro Bowl nine times and led the NFL in running eight times.
